Professional statement

Leslie Doyle is a Licensed Mental Health Counselor who cares deeply about helping others feel at home within themselves. She is committed to nurturing authenticity, empowering personal growth, and walking alongside clients on their unique healing paths. Leslie works with a wide range of experiences and has a particular passion for supporting trauma survivors (including developmental, acute, and complex trauma), caregivers, military families, and individuals with foster care backgrounds. She also welcomes fellow therapists into her practice, offering a grounded and supportive space for healing and reflection.

Her approach is integrative, relational, and attuned to the whole person. Leslie blends Internal Family Systems (IFS) parts work, somatic therapy, creative expression, mindfulness, spiritual therapy, NARM, and EMDR to help clients access their inner wisdom and reconnect with their needs, values, and longings. By building inner safety and greater tolerance for the present moment, clients are supported in moving toward more freedom, clarity, and self-compassion.

Leslie brings a rich and varied background to her therapeutic work. In addition to her clinical training in Counseling Psychology, she holds certifications in Trauma-Informed Yoga, Ayurvedic Wellness, and Herbalism, and has professional experience in higher education, sustainable living, and the arts. Her presence is warm, grounded, and inclusive—offering clients the opportunity to engage in therapy that honors their full complexity.

Leslie currently offers remote sessions to adult clients in Colorado, Washington, and Florida. She is based in Basalt, Colorado, just outside of Aspen, and works exclusively via telehealth.
